Update to 19.7.0

Signed-off-by: Stephen Gallagher <sgallagh@redhat.com>
This commit is contained in:
Stephen Gallagher 2023-02-21 14:30:38 -05:00
parent 960b2f524d
commit a35607a1c3
No known key found for this signature in database
GPG Key ID: 45DB85A568286D11
5 changed files with 27 additions and 14 deletions

View File

@ -1,4 +1,4 @@
From dcfc1ddd79e6bf9c7d3066e7c9e466e51011adac Mon Sep 17 00:00:00 2001 From 694be95b2b7f82ec1f053f652c6f297b3f521fb0 Mon Sep 17 00:00:00 2001
From: Zuzana Svetlikova <zsvetlik@redhat.com> From: Zuzana Svetlikova <zsvetlik@redhat.com>
Date: Fri, 17 Apr 2020 12:59:44 +0200 Date: Fri, 17 Apr 2020 12:59:44 +0200
Subject: [PATCH] Disable running gyp on shared deps Subject: [PATCH] Disable running gyp on shared deps
@ -10,7 +10,7 @@ Signed-off-by: rpm-build <rpm-build>
2 files changed, 2 insertions(+), 19 deletions(-) 2 files changed, 2 insertions(+), 19 deletions(-)
diff --git a/Makefile b/Makefile diff --git a/Makefile b/Makefile
index 94013466239e9c43ddce5cebc7a8d0a4dc56db4f..8577570c95d20dcf8d3dfe5d9fe82c1f67b2d70a 100644 index 830413fdba81da34a56b8a6aabfca3eacda1684d..21f7de35fa36183b30c6f996894b134f80421df4 100644
--- a/Makefile --- a/Makefile
+++ b/Makefile +++ b/Makefile
@@ -169,7 +169,7 @@ with-code-cache test-code-cache: @@ -169,7 +169,7 @@ with-code-cache test-code-cache:
@ -19,10 +19,10 @@ index 94013466239e9c43ddce5cebc7a8d0a4dc56db4f..8577570c95d20dcf8d3dfe5d9fe82c1f
out/Makefile: config.gypi common.gypi node.gyp \ out/Makefile: config.gypi common.gypi node.gyp \
- deps/uv/uv.gyp deps/llhttp/llhttp.gyp deps/zlib/zlib.gyp \ - deps/uv/uv.gyp deps/llhttp/llhttp.gyp deps/zlib/zlib.gyp \
+ deps/llhttp/llhttp.gyp \ + deps/llhttp/llhttp.gyp \
deps/simdutf/simdutf.gyp \ deps/simdutf/simdutf.gyp deps/ada/ada.gyp \
tools/v8_gypfiles/toolchain.gypi tools/v8_gypfiles/features.gypi \ tools/v8_gypfiles/toolchain.gypi tools/v8_gypfiles/features.gypi \
tools/v8_gypfiles/inspector.gypi tools/v8_gypfiles/v8.gyp tools/v8_gypfiles/inspector.gypi tools/v8_gypfiles/v8.gyp
@@ -1550,7 +1550,7 @@ CONFLICT_RE=^>>>>>>> [[:xdigit:]]+|^<<<<<<< [[:alpha:]]+ @@ -1556,7 +1556,7 @@ CONFLICT_RE=^>>>>>>> [[:xdigit:]]+|^<<<<<<< [[:alpha:]]+
# Related CI job: node-test-linter # Related CI job: node-test-linter
lint-ci: lint-js-ci lint-cpp lint-py lint-md lint-addon-docs lint-yaml-build lint-yaml lint-ci: lint-js-ci lint-cpp lint-py lint-md lint-addon-docs lint-yaml-build lint-yaml
@ -32,10 +32,10 @@ index 94013466239e9c43ddce5cebc7a8d0a4dc56db4f..8577570c95d20dcf8d3dfe5d9fe82c1f
exit 0 ; \ exit 0 ; \
else \ else \
diff --git a/node.gyp b/node.gyp diff --git a/node.gyp b/node.gyp
index b0f132efd82edcd114612d25cd3316379b2097a4..f091b165cbb9efccbe16a6e595a32b311248939b 100644 index 6d1b2bf36902cf54f33513873441c403c2e7ee3d..e5c1f696ffb14421df1a5626be6cf1c6738d870e 100644
--- a/node.gyp --- a/node.gyp
+++ b/node.gyp +++ b/node.gyp
@@ -420,23 +420,6 @@ @@ -421,23 +421,6 @@
], ],
}, },
], ],

View File

@ -293,6 +293,11 @@ echo "========================="
echo "${UNDICI_VERSION}" echo "${UNDICI_VERSION}"
echo "WASI-SDK: ${UNDICI_WASI_MAJOR}.${UNDICI_WASI_MINOR}" echo "WASI-SDK: ${UNDICI_WASI_MAJOR}.${UNDICI_WASI_MINOR}"
echo echo
echo "ada"
echo "========================="
ADA_VERSION=$(grep -oP '(?<=#define ADA_VERSION ).*\"' node-v${version}/deps/ada/ada.h |sed -e 's/^"//' -e 's/"$//')
echo "${ADA_VERSION}
echo
echo "Applying versions to spec template" echo "Applying versions to spec template"
sed -e "s/@NODE_PKG_MAJOR@/${NODE_PKG_MAJOR}/g" \ sed -e "s/@NODE_PKG_MAJOR@/${NODE_PKG_MAJOR}/g" \
@ -322,6 +327,7 @@ sed -e "s/@NODE_PKG_MAJOR@/${NODE_PKG_MAJOR}/g" \
-e "s/@UNDICI_VERSION@/${UNDICI_VERSION}/g" \ -e "s/@UNDICI_VERSION@/${UNDICI_VERSION}/g" \
-e "s/@UNDICI_WASI_MAJOR@/${UNDICI_WASI_MAJOR}/g" \ -e "s/@UNDICI_WASI_MAJOR@/${UNDICI_WASI_MAJOR}/g" \
-e "s/@UNDICI_WASI_MINOR@/${UNDICI_WASI_MINOR}/g" \ -e "s/@UNDICI_WASI_MINOR@/${UNDICI_WASI_MINOR}/g" \
-e "s/@ADA_VERSION@/${ADA_VERSION}/g" \
${SCRIPT_DIR}/packaging/nodejs.spec.in \ ${SCRIPT_DIR}/packaging/nodejs.spec.in \
> ${SCRIPT_DIR}/nodejs${NODE_PKG_MAJOR}.spec > ${SCRIPT_DIR}/nodejs${NODE_PKG_MAJOR}.spec

View File

@ -44,8 +44,8 @@
# than a Fedora release lifecycle. # than a Fedora release lifecycle.
%global nodejs_epoch 1 %global nodejs_epoch 1
%global nodejs_major 19 %global nodejs_major 19
%global nodejs_minor 6 %global nodejs_minor 7
%global nodejs_patch 1 %global nodejs_patch 0
%global nodejs_abi %{nodejs_major}.%{nodejs_minor} %global nodejs_abi %{nodejs_major}.%{nodejs_minor}
# nodejs_soversion - from NODE_MODULE_VERSION in src/node_version.h # nodejs_soversion - from NODE_MODULE_VERSION in src/node_version.h
%global nodejs_soversion 111 %global nodejs_soversion 111
@ -79,7 +79,7 @@
# c-ares - from deps/cares/include/ares_version.h # c-ares - from deps/cares/include/ares_version.h
# https://github.com/nodejs/node/pull/9332 # https://github.com/nodejs/node/pull/9332
%global c_ares_version 1.18.1 %global c_ares_version 1.19.0
# llhttp - from deps/llhttp/include/llhttp.h # llhttp - from deps/llhttp/include/llhttp.h
%global llhttp_version 8.1.0 %global llhttp_version 8.1.0
@ -111,7 +111,7 @@
# npm - from deps/npm/package.json # npm - from deps/npm/package.json
%global npm_epoch 1 %global npm_epoch 1
%global npm_version 9.4.0 %global npm_version 9.5.0
# In order to avoid needing to keep incrementing the release version for the # In order to avoid needing to keep incrementing the release version for the
# main package forever, we will just construct one for npm that is guaranteed # main package forever, we will just construct one for npm that is guaranteed
@ -158,7 +158,7 @@ Source100: nodejs-sources.sh
# These are generated by nodejs-sources.sh # These are generated by nodejs-sources.sh
Source101: cjs-module-lexer-1.2.2-stripped.tar.gz Source101: cjs-module-lexer-1.2.2-stripped.tar.gz
Source102: wasi-sdk-11.0-linux.tar.gz Source102: wasi-sdk-11.0-linux.tar.gz
Source111: undici-5.19.1-stripped.tar.gz Source111: undici-5.20.0-stripped.tar.gz
Source112: wasi-sdk-14.0-linux.tar.gz Source112: wasi-sdk-14.0-linux.tar.gz
# Disable running gyp on bundled deps we don't use # Disable running gyp on bundled deps we don't use

View File

@ -129,6 +129,9 @@
# histogram_c - assumed from timestamps # histogram_c - assumed from timestamps
%global histogram_version 0.9.7 %global histogram_version 0.9.7
# ada URL parser
%global ada_version @ADA_VERSION@
Name: nodejs@NODE_PKG_MAJOR@ Name: nodejs@NODE_PKG_MAJOR@
Epoch: %{nodejs_epoch} Epoch: %{nodejs_epoch}
@ -301,6 +304,10 @@ Provides: bundled(icu) = %{icu_version}
Provides: bundled(uvwasi) = %{uvwasi_version} Provides: bundled(uvwasi) = %{uvwasi_version}
Provides: bundled(histogram) = %{histogram_version} Provides: bundled(histogram) = %{histogram_version}
# Upstream has added a new URL parser that has no option to build as a shared
# library (19.7.0+)
Provides: bundled(ada) = ${ada_version}
%description %description
Node.js is a platform built on Chrome's JavaScript runtime \ Node.js is a platform built on Chrome's JavaScript runtime \

View File

@ -1,7 +1,7 @@
SHA512 (node-v19.6.1-stripped.tar.gz) = d766ec2b41cacedb8bfa03777f81ee1caafca56b523f6dac1a99020a54a635ffc957b1579d114103b1950bcad2e9efd7aa857f9c89cbcc998b7f7fec351b2ed5 SHA512 (node-v19.7.0-stripped.tar.gz) = 44185c053a1dceec32e1b96e82d67bcdb392b38c31faac434d4b2d85af881691abb08035015aff7f392e580a0f410aa84b879d65c929ce9c9994f7ce2bb4ae05
SHA512 (icu4c-72_1-data-bin-b.zip) = ed0ce3ebd02f81cca7b3808abc72dc99962eb36bd123ebdf45c578b307b674566491191b6f7d261c679b2b5662b7084c61452b98968b35df3f749d413d5d7663 SHA512 (icu4c-72_1-data-bin-b.zip) = ed0ce3ebd02f81cca7b3808abc72dc99962eb36bd123ebdf45c578b307b674566491191b6f7d261c679b2b5662b7084c61452b98968b35df3f749d413d5d7663
SHA512 (icu4c-72_1-data-bin-l.zip) = cc9a8cf2a89dacde4fab4a68ca7a7ba1fd106b71ebc23318fb9293ab96001be825bf89b1daf3da02958ba201ca4f714a67a26db3a51dc03653b9970ebdd5ff56 SHA512 (icu4c-72_1-data-bin-l.zip) = cc9a8cf2a89dacde4fab4a68ca7a7ba1fd106b71ebc23318fb9293ab96001be825bf89b1daf3da02958ba201ca4f714a67a26db3a51dc03653b9970ebdd5ff56
SHA512 (cjs-module-lexer-1.2.2-stripped.tar.gz) = 6604250b609c8e6262f0601dbbd14745a6318bcb7d72ecc46a037c2239d69a0267d9fa6dfa26e676e117c36ed544ea302f18765defa8211cb02e9b3850ed1f58 SHA512 (cjs-module-lexer-1.2.2-stripped.tar.gz) = e5dc3bad8f94cc307aa4ebc6ae125d04051245986c909d179321de4694c60c932ef49585eb62af35ce9497d30439e30b0549e767c1c654296d2c5c13827bfdd2
SHA512 (wasi-sdk-11.0-linux.tar.gz) = e3ed4597f7f2290967eef6238e9046f60abbcb8633a4a2a51525d00e7393df8df637a98a5b668217d332dd44fcbf2442ec7efd5e65724e888d90611164451e20 SHA512 (wasi-sdk-11.0-linux.tar.gz) = e3ed4597f7f2290967eef6238e9046f60abbcb8633a4a2a51525d00e7393df8df637a98a5b668217d332dd44fcbf2442ec7efd5e65724e888d90611164451e20
SHA512 (undici-5.19.1-stripped.tar.gz) = a6ea6ffcead6c6012707a87d0f3d4716ef493ee4c362f58c4e3d7007bba91a65d3e040b79528ea389ed2a087c5413487584c5b4356b3e679dd83e3f3142f5650 SHA512 (undici-5.20.0-stripped.tar.gz) = d92d5895b641d2570030a35e0d88af9450541ff0557d9ed3fe16d60a51828e28e5cb00affe32036773487f97a287a30ca5f655a1679e113d64168a0d2b5bbf40
SHA512 (wasi-sdk-14.0-linux.tar.gz) = 288a367e051f5b3f5853de97fabaedd3acf2255819d50c24f48f573897518500ea808342fd9aea832b2a5717089807bf1cbcf6d46b156b4eb60cc6b3c02ee997 SHA512 (wasi-sdk-14.0-linux.tar.gz) = 288a367e051f5b3f5853de97fabaedd3acf2255819d50c24f48f573897518500ea808342fd9aea832b2a5717089807bf1cbcf6d46b156b4eb60cc6b3c02ee997